区块链原理架构与应用PDF下载
- By ok钱包APP
- 2024-05-22 03:38:07
内容大纲:
1. 什么是区块链?
a. 区块链定义
b. 区块链的基本原理
2. 区块链的架构
a. 分布式网络
b. 共识机制
c. 数据存储结构
3. 区块链的应用领域
a. 金融行业
b. 物流行业
c. 零售行业
d. 医疗行业
e. 政府部门
4. 区块链是如何实现去中心化的?
a. 去中心化的概念
b. 区块链如何实现去中心化
5. 区块链的共识机制有哪些?
a. 共识机制的意义
b. 常见的共识机制
c. 区块链中的共识机制应用举例
6. 区块链如何保证数据的安全性?
a. 加密算法的应用
b. 通过分布式网络保障数据安全
c. 数据完整性的验证
7. 区块链在金融行业的应用有哪些?
a. 区块链在支付结算领域的应用
b. 区块链在贷款与融资领域的应用
c. 区块链在资产管理领域的应用
8. 区块链在物流行业的应用有哪些?
a. 区块链在供应链管理中的应用
b. 区块链在溯源与追踪领域的应用
c. 区块链在物流信息共享中的应用
区块链是如何实现去中心化的?
区块链的核心理念之一就是去中心化,它意味着没有一个中央机构或个人拥有对整个网络的控制权。实现去中心化的关键是通过分布式网络和共识机制来达成一致性和安全性。
在区块链中,每个节点都有一个完整的副本,节点之间通过P2P协议进行通信和数据传输。当有新的交易需要被添加到区块链中时,节点通过共识机制进行验证和确认,如果达到共识,则将该交易添加到区块中,并通过算法连接到之前的区块。这样,所有的节点都会同步更新自己的区块链副本,实现了去中心化的目标。
区块链的共识机制有哪些?
共识机制是区块链中确保节点之间达成一致的重要机制。常见的共识机制有工作量证明(Proof of Work,PoW)、权益证明(Proof of Stake,PoS)、权益证明股份(Delegated Proof of Stake,DPoS)等。
工作量证明是比特币中广泛采用的共识机制,通过解决一定难度的数学问题来获得记账权,工作量越大的节点获得记账的机会越高。
权益证明则是根据节点拥有的货币数量和持有时间,来确定记账权的分配比例,拥有更多货币的节点将有更高的机会被选为记账节点。
权益证明股份是在权益证明的基础上,引入了代理角色,由代理节点代表其他节点进行记账工作,加快交易确认速度。
区块链如何保证数据的安全性?
区块链通过多种方式确保数据的安全性。首先,区块链使用加密算法对数据进行加密,确保只有拥有相应私钥的人可以解密和访问数据。
其次,区块链使用分布式网络进行数据存储和传输,这意味着数据会分散存储在各个节点上,大大降低了数据被攻击或篡改的风险。即使某个节点被攻击,其他节点依然可以验证数据的完整性。
此外,区块链中的每个区块都包含了前一个区块的哈希值,形成了一个不可篡改的数据链。如果有人试图修改某个区块的数据,需要同时修改该区块后面的所有区块,这是几乎不可能的。
区块链在金融行业的应用有哪些?
区块链在金融行业有广泛的应用,其中包括以下几个方面:
- 支付结算领域:区块链可以实现快速、安全、可追溯的跨境支付,降低汇款和清算的成本,提高支付的效率。
- 贷款与融资领域:借助区块链技术,可以建立信用评估体系、实现智能合约,简化贷款与融资过程,提高借贷效率和减少欺诈风险。
- 资产管理领域:通过区块链的不可篡改和可追溯性,可以实现资产的数字化和交易的透明化,提高资产管理的效率和可信度。
区块链在物流行业的应用有哪些?
区块链在物流行业具有广泛的应用潜力,以下是几个典型的应用场景:
- 供应链管理:通过区块链技术,可以实现对供应链各环节的数据追踪和溯源,确保产品的质量和安全性。
- 溯源与追踪:利用区块链的不可篡改性和可追溯性,可以对食品、药品等商品的生产、加工、运输等环节进行可视化和验证,提高产品溯源的精确度和可信度。
- 物流信息共享:区块链可以实现物流信息的共享和交换,提高物流效率,减少信息不对称和操纵的可能性。
以上仅是区块链在金融和物流行业的部分应用,随着技术的不断发展和应用场景的不断拓展,区块链将给更多行业带来变革和创新。